Abstract
The invention discloses a kind of orthopedic operating tantalum bar system, including tantalum stick, it is characterised in that:The system comprises the protection pipes for accommodating tantalum stick, and the both ends open of protection pipe, inner cavity is hollow, and horizontal annulus is provided on the tube wall of the upper end of protection pipe.Bolt hole is provided on the annulus.Present invention employs one layer of fender bracket of external package in tantalum stick, so design can ensure that tantalum stick will not be crushed when being implanted into embedded hole, ensure the integrality of tantalum stick.Annulus in protection pipe can cause protection pipe to be fixed in drilling, it is ensured that the stability of protection pipe.

Background technology
The femoral joint of human body is very important component, in the case that lesion, such as joint failure occur for hip joint, needs
It takes out the tissue of necrosis and then some artificial materials is filled into femoral joint.The packing material used at present is mostly porous tantalum material
Material.During operation, first electricity consumption is drilled on femoral joint and drills, and then takes out joint tissue downright bad in hole, then tantalum stick is inserted hole
It is interior, finally with health broken bone tissue blind and sew up a wound.
But during implantation, tantalum stick needs to bear larger power, some tantalum sticks will be twisted off or last
It is knocked off when filling broken bone.

Specific embodiment
The present invention is described further in the following with reference to the drawings and specific embodiments.
As shown in Fig. 1 to Figure 14, a kind of orthopedic operating tantalum bar system, including tantalum stick 1-1, the system comprises accommodate tantalum
The protection pipe 1-2 of stick, the both ends open of protection pipe, inner cavity is hollow, and horizontal circle is provided on the tube wall of the upper end of protection pipe
Ring 1-3.Screw hole 1-4 is provided on the annulus, the annulus and protection pipe are an integral structure, the protection tube wall
Upper inner be provided with salient point 1-5.
In use, protection pipe is put into drilling first, screw hole is passed through to follow closely on bone with screw, in this way by protection pipe jail
The fixation in jail, then tantalum stick is pressed into protection pipe, the top of real protection pipe is finally beaten with broken bone, the effect of salient point is in order to better
Increase the friction between broken bone and protection pipe.
